Guide to hiring a CRO agency

Conversion rate optimisation (CRO) is the discipline of systematically improving the percentage of website visitors who take a desired action — making a purchase, filling in a form, or booking a demo. Even small improvements in conversion rate can dramatically outperform equivalent gains in traffic.

What is CRO?

CRO combines quantitative analysis (Google Analytics, heatmaps, session recordings, funnel analysis) with qualitative research (user interviews, surveys, usability testing) to identify friction points in the user journey. Agencies then design, develop, and test solutions through A/B and multivariate testing, iterating based on statistical significance before rolling out winning variants.

When should you hire a CRO agency?

CRO delivers the highest ROI when your site already has meaningful traffic (typically 10,000+ monthly visitors to key landing pages) but conversion rates feel low for your sector. It's particularly valuable before scaling paid advertising — fixing conversion leaks first means every pound of ad spend works harder.

What to look for in a CRO agency

  • Rigorous testing methodology — proper statistical significance thresholds, not cherry-picked results
  • Data-first approach — they should review your Analytics, heatmaps, and recordings before recommending anything
  • Development capability — can they build the test variants themselves, or do they need your team's involvement?
  • Communication of hypothesis and learnings — what did this test teach us, win or lose?
  • Experience with your platform (Shopify, WordPress, custom stack)

How much does CRO cost?

CRO agency retainers typically range from £2,000–£5,000/month for ongoing testing programmes (2–4 tests per month), up to £8,000–£15,000/month for comprehensive programmes with research, UX design, and high-velocity testing. One-time CRO audits and roadmaps typically cost £3,000–£8,000.

Frequently asked questions about CRO agencies

What's a good conversion rate for my website?

It varies widely by industry, traffic source, and conversion type. eCommerce average is 2–4%; B2B lead generation landing pages typically convert at 3–8%. The most meaningful benchmark is your own historical performance — are you improving month over month?

How long does a CRO test need to run?

Tests need to reach statistical significance, which requires a sufficient number of conversions per variant — typically 300–500 conversions per variant minimum. This can take 2–8 weeks depending on your traffic volume. Running tests for too short a period leads to false conclusions.
